DESIGN FOR A GAME-BOARD.
SPECIFICATION forming part of Design No. 25,312, dated March 31, 1896.
Application filed August/3,1395. Serial No. 558,024. Term of patent 3i years.
To all whom it may concern:
Be it known that I, EDWIN P. SLOCOMB, a citizen of the United States, and a resident of \Vilmington, in the county of New Castle and State of Delaware, have invented a certain new and useful Design for Game-Boards; and I do declare the following to be a full, clear, and exact description of the invention, such as will enable others skilled in the art to which it appertains to make and use the same, reference being had to the accompanying drawing, and to letters of reference marked thereon, which forms a part of this specification.
The drawing is a representation of the invention and is a top plan view.
This invention relates to a certain new and original design for game-boards; and it con sists in the novel form and configuration thereof, as hereinafter described, and illustrated in the accompanying drawing.
On a circular field A is marked a polygon B. \Vithin this polygon is inscribed a sec ond polygon having the same number of sides as the first. Connecting the angles of the two similar polygons is a series of radial lines E. At the center of the field is a star-shaped figure F, which presents a central opening f. At each angle of both polygons is seen an opening a, and the outer polygon presents a similar opening I) midway between each of the openings a.
Having thus described the invention, what I claim is The design for a game-board substantially as herein shown and described.
